Top Options Compared: Basic, Padded, Recycled, Custom
Poly mailers best practices also mean Choosing the Right style of mailer for the job instead of assuming every product deserves the same bag. That is how people end up buying heavy-duty packaging for lightweight tees or underpacking a product that clearly needed more protection. Neither outcome is smart, and both are easy to avoid with a little discipline.
The four common options are basic white or gray poly mailers, padded poly mailers, recycled-content mailers, and custom-printed mailers. All four can work. None of them are magic. The right choice depends on product type, order volume, brand presentation, and how much damage you are willing to tolerate before the cheap option stops looking cheap.
| Option | Best For | Typical Thickness / Build | Typical Unit Price at 5,000 Pieces | What Usually Wins | Common Tradeoff |
|---|---|---|---|---|---|
| Basic white or gray poly mailers | Apparel, soft goods, repeat shipments | 2.5-3 mil film, peel-and-seal closure | $0.09-$0.18 | Lowest cost, light weight, easy storage | Less presentation value, lower puncture margin |
| Padded poly mailers | Small accessories, jewelry pouches, cords, light fragile items | Outer film plus bubble or paper padding | $0.18-$0.38 | Better crush protection without a box | Higher cost and more bulk |
| Recycled-content poly mailers | Brands with sustainability claims and standard apparel shipping | Usually 2.5-3 mil recycled blend | $0.12-$0.26 | Cleaner story, lighter waste profile | Quality varies more by supplier |
| Custom-printed poly mailers | Branded ecommerce, subscription kits, retail fulfillment | 2.5-3 mil, printed exterior, peel-and-seal | $0.18-$0.45 | Brand lift, better unboxing, stronger recall | Setup time, MOQ, artwork approvals |
Basic white and gray mailers are the default for a reason. They are cheap, light, and easy to store. For high-volume apparel shipping, they often make the most sense because the product itself is the presentation. If the order is a folded tee, a pair of socks, or a simple soft good, plain mailers can do the job without pushing cost upward.
Padded poly mailers make sense when the item needs a little crush protection but not enough to justify a corrugated box. Think small accessories, cable kits, light cosmetics, and non-brittle products that still benefit from cushion. They are not a substitute for real protective packaging, but they are useful when the product needs a little insurance and you want to avoid the cubic weight penalty of a box.

Detailed Reviews: What Actually Performs in Shipping
Poly mailers best practices are easier to understand once the talk shifts from slogans to performance. Tear resistance, puncture resistance, closure strength, and moisture handling are the quiet details that decide whether a shipment arrives clean or lands in customer service with a problem.
Basic poly mailers usually perform well on everyday apparel if the seams are clean and the film thickness is honest. A 2.5 mil mailer can be fine for light garments, but that does not mean every 2.5 mil mailer is fine. The film blend, the weld strength at the seams, and the adhesive strip matter just as much as the printed spec. In practice, a mediocre 3 mil mailer can perform worse than a good 2.5 mil one, which is one reason the spec sheet by itself can be kind of misleading.
Padded poly mailers solve a different problem. They help with light crush resistance and reduce the chance of a small item being dented or scuffed. They are not armor. They are a sensible middle path when a product needs a little protection and you do not want to pay for a box and void fill. For subscription kits, compact accessories, and fragile-looking items that are not truly fragile, padded mailers can be a solid fit.
Recycled Poly Mailers are worth serious consideration if the quality is there. Poly mailers best practices do not say never use recycled film. They say test recycled film the same way you would test any other film. Check whether the seal grabs well, whether the film stretches instead of tearing too easily, and whether the surface stays stable under normal warehouse conditions. A recycled option that fails in sorting is not sustainable. It is just waste with better copy.
Custom-printed mailers add a branding layer, but they also add pressure to get the base structure right. If the adhesive strip is weak, the print will not save it. If the seam splits, the logo becomes a label on a problem. That is why poly mailers best practices always put structure first and decoration second.
What tends to fail first
In real shipping, the weak point is usually not the center film. It is the seam, the corner, or the seal strip. Overstuffing is another classic mistake. If the mailer looks like a sausage casing, the size is already wrong. People keep doing this because they want to save on per-unit cost, then they act surprised when the package bursts open after a hard corner hit.
Cold conditions can make closure failures worse. Adhesive that works fine in a warm packing room may lose grip in an unheated warehouse or on a winter route. Heat can cause other problems, especially if the adhesive becomes too soft and the flap shifts during handling. Poly mailers best practices mean checking closure performance in the temperature range your operation actually sees, not just at a comfortable desk-side sample test.
Common use cases that make sense
Apparel is the obvious winner. T-shirts, leggings, loungewear, swimsuits, and socks are made for mailers because they compress nicely and do not need rigid protection. Soft home goods like pillow covers, towels, and lightweight linens also fit well. Subscription kits can work too, as long as the contents are not brittle and the insert layout keeps movement under control.
For anything with edges, corners, or hard inserts, test carefully. A hair accessory in a soft pouch is one thing. A small metal item with sharp edges is another. Poly mailers best practices are about matching risk to packaging, not forcing every product into the same shipping bag because it is cheaper on paper.

Production Steps and Lead Time
Poly mailers best practices also include understanding how these things are actually made, because lead time surprises usually come from the same predictable places. A packaging buyer who knows the process can plan inventory without guessing, and guessing is how launch dates get wrecked.
The order flow usually starts with size selection. That sounds obvious, yet people still guess based on product dimensions alone and forget the extra thickness from folding, inserts, tissue, and labels. Once the size is set, artwork approval comes next for custom runs. Stock mailers move faster because there is no print stage, no color match, and no back-and-forth over whether the logo should sit 3 millimeters higher or lower. I wish that was a joke, but anyone who has sat through proof rounds knows better.
For custom orders, sample approval is where the timeline often slows down. If the sample looks wrong, everything stops. If the color is off, the file gets revised. If the closure test fails, the material spec changes. Poly mailers best practices say to build those revisions into the schedule instead of pretending they will never happen. A buyer who promises a launch before approvals are locked is basically setting up a warehouse excuse tour.
- Select the spec: size, thickness, seal type, and whether you need plain, padded, recycled, or printed.
- Approve artwork: confirm logo placement, color targets, and any required copy.
- Request a sample: test with your real product, not a dummy bag with no weight.
- Confirm production: lock the order only after the sample performs properly.
- Plan freight and receiving: leave room for inbound transit, customs if applicable, and warehouse intake.
Stock poly mailers can often ship in a few business days if inventory is on hand. Custom-printed runs usually take longer, often around 10-18 business days after proof approval, depending on print complexity, film availability, and factory queue. Special colors, heavier film, or recycled blends can stretch that further. That is normal. It is not a conspiracy. It is just the real timeline showing up whether anyone likes it or not.

Cost, Pricing, and MOQ: What the Real Numbers Mean
Poly mailers best practices should always include a sober look at pricing, because sticker price alone lies. A lower unit quote can still cost more once you add freight, storage, damage, and the price of shipping a replacement order. That is the part people ignore when they are busy chasing the lowest number in the spreadsheet.
At a practical level, basic stock mailers are usually the cheapest option. Recycled-content mailers often sit a bit higher. Padded mailers cost more because the build is more complex and heavier. Custom printed mailers add setup, print, and often a higher MOQ. The trick is not to ask which is cheapest. The trick is to ask which one produces the lowest landed cost per successful shipment. That is a very different question, and it is the one that matters.
| Cost Factor | How It Moves Price | What to Watch |
|---|---|---|
| Film thickness | Thicker film usually raises unit cost | Do not buy extra thickness unless the product needs it |
| Print coverage | More color and coverage increase setup and ink cost | Simple one-color branding can keep costs sane |
| MOQ | Higher quantities usually drop unit cost | Only buy volume you can store and actually use |
| Freight | Heavier or bulkier packaging costs more to move | Low unit price can get eaten by shipping charges |
| Defect rate | Failures create hidden replacement and labor costs | A cheap run with bad seals is not cheap at all |
MOQ is where small brands get trapped. A quote may look excellent until you notice it requires 10,000 units and you only ship 400 orders a month. Now you are paying to store packaging for a year and tying up cash in a color you might stop using. Poly mailers best practices say the MOQ should fit your demand curve, not your ego, and that advice saves more money than a lot of fancy sourcing tricks.
On custom orders, the best pricing usually appears at higher volume, but only up to the point where storage and design flexibility start getting painful. If your brand refreshes graphics often, a smaller run can be smarter even if the unit price is a little higher. Dead inventory is expensive. It does not get cheaper just because it is sitting quietly in a corner.
Freight matters more than people think. A small difference in film weight, bag size, or carton count can change your landed cost enough to erase the savings you thought you had. Poly mailers best practices mean comparing not only the quote, but also the carton pack, pallet count, and inbound freight estimate before you say yes.

How to Choose the Right Poly Mailer
Poly mailers best practices become easy once you stop trying to choose from a catalog and start choosing from your actual shipment profile. Product weight, breakability, retail value, and brand presentation all matter. A 7-ounce garment in a plain mailer is a different problem from a bundled kit with inserts, a thank-you card, and a product that scratches if you look at it wrong.
My basic decision tree is simple. If the product is soft, non-fragile, and low risk, choose a plain mailer. If the item needs light protection or has a little more bulk, step up to padded. If sustainability messaging matters and the supplier can prove the film performs, consider recycled-content. If the package is part of the brand experience and you ship enough volume to justify it, custom-printed is the move. That is poly mailers best practices without the fluff.
Size testing matters more than dimension math. Measure the real packed order, not just the product. Add folding allowance, inserts, tags, and any seasonal variation in garment bulk. Then pack a sample and close the mailer. If the flap needs to be forced down, the bag is too small. If the item sloshes around like a loose tooth, it is too big. Neither case is smart.
Thickness should follow abuse risk, not just weight. A heavier item can still be soft and safe in a standard film, while a lighter item with sharp edges may need a stronger build. Seal type also matters. A peel-and-seal adhesive strip is common, but not all adhesives are equal. Some grab well and stay put. Others act like they are doing you a favor for the first 30 seconds, then lose interest.
Poly mailers best practices also call for a real shipment test. Do not just drop one bag onto a carpet and call it verified. Run a few packed samples through the same kind of handling your orders will see. If possible, include a short vibration and drop test based on the kind of transit abuse that common packaging protocols like ISTA are designed to simulate. You do not need a lab coat to understand whether a package can survive a truck route, but you do need to resist the temptation to wing it.
